You are viewing a plain text version of this content. The canonical link for it is here.
Posted to commits@maven.apache.org by gi...@apache.org on 2023/02/18 13:29:26 UTC

[maven-doxia] branch dependabot/maven/org.apache.commons-commons-text-1.10.0 updated (7b364114 -> d11a4bf5)

This is an automated email from the ASF dual-hosted git repository.

github-bot pushed a change to branch dependabot/maven/org.apache.commons-commons-text-1.10.0
in repository https://gitbox.apache.org/repos/asf/maven-doxia.git


 discard 7b364114 Bump commons-text from 1.9 to 1.10.0
     add d98362ba Simplify boxed code handling
     add 61000025 [DOXIA-676] Remove all obsolete elements in HTML5 and add new ones
     add fd24f2e0 [DOXIA-671] Double quotes contained in markdown page are removed in HTML output
     add 1b2e9a98 [DOXIA-670] Drop dead XdocSink#link(String, String) method
     add 13dcd963 [DOXIA-672] Parse id attribute only on <a /> elements by default
     add 77f3c139 [DOXIA-673] Remove compat handling of absent Sink#tableRows() calls
     add be34bdd7 [DOXIA-674] Replace table border handling with new CSS class
     add 4c5b2255 [DOXIA-675] Replace table alignment attributes with CSS styles
     add 380a4895 [DOXIA-668] Remove all obsolete attributes in HTML5
     add 65d20f83 [maven-release-plugin] prepare release doxia-2.0.0-M4
     add dba10ae9 [maven-release-plugin] prepare for next development iteration
     add b9a4ff88 [DOXIA-678] Add missing elements in Xhtml5BaseParser
     add 39e05e34 update Reproducible Builds badge link
     add ea7bc882 [DOXIA-679] Introduce Sink#tableRows(void) method
     add 3734db14 [DOXIA-681] Upgrade Plexus Utils to 3.5.0
     add cf5858a7 [DOXIA-680] Don't wrap elements in anchors
     add e6848f9e [DOXIA-684] avoid flexmark-all: declare used extensions only
     add df935386 [DOXIA-569] add Markdown sink implementation
     add 56cd5cb1 [DOXIA-569] generate Doxia 2.x title levels
     add d2f824ed [DOXIA-617] support yaml metadata
     add 7f8219fb [MNGSITE-505] use dlcdn.apache.org (no mirrors) + downloads.apache.org
     add 4605502a [DOXIA-569] fix javadoc
     add 6a60ee45 [DOXIA-686] Upgrade to Maven Parent 39
     add 3af3b813 [DOXIA-687] Introduce Sink#verbatim(void) method
     add bb53b6d4 Remove incorrect Javadoc statements
     add 4bf7febd [DOXIA-688] Remove empty alt attribute value on images which causes the browser not to render replacement icon
     add 7509feb0 [DOXIA-689] Restore incorrectly removed (HTML5) attributes
     add b8a7fdf0 Remove duplicate license headers
     add 5d80cf3b [DOXIA-686] reformat javadoc
     add 75e47d64 [DOXIA-686] fix too aggressive reformat
     add 73a00a9d [DOXIA-685] Replace SinkEventAttributes#BOXED with #SOURCE to clearly separate between regular verbatim and verbatim source (code)
     add 30254b41 [maven-release-plugin] prepare release doxia-2.0.0-M5
     add 423cd561 [maven-release-plugin] prepare for next development iteration
     add d35b94df Fix Javadoc
     add 97c01058 [DOXIA-691] emit multiple authors in separate tags (#142)
     add ab13591c [DOXIA-690] Improved support of metadata (both YAML front matter and MultiMarkdown) (#141)
     add 6fd45daa [DOXIA-692] Fix escaping of special characters (#143)
     add 65fead6b Add test for parsing font styles including escape characters (#144)
     add 67e13c42 [DOXIA-693] Fix prefix for ordered list item prefixes (#145)
     add 218b5afa Migrate remaining component from Plexus to JSR 330 annotations (#147)
     add d11a4bf5 Bump commons-text from 1.9 to 1.10.0

This update added new revisions after undoing existing revisions.
That is to say, some revisions that were in the old version of the
branch are not in the new version.  This situation occurs
when a user --force pushes a change and generates a repository
containing something like this:

 * -- * -- B -- O -- O -- O   (7b364114)
            \
             N -- N -- N   refs/heads/dependabot/maven/org.apache.commons-commons-text-1.10.0 (d11a4bf5)

You should already have received notification emails for all of the O
revisions, and so the following emails describe only the N revisions
from the common base, B.

Any revisions marked "omit" are not gone; other references still
refer to them.  Any revisions marked "discard" are gone forever.

No new revisions were added by this update.

Summary of changes:
 .../maven-verify.yml => .git-blame-ignore-revs     |   16 +-
 README.md                                          |    2 +-
 doxia-core/pom.xml                                 |    9 +-
 .../java/org/apache/maven/doxia/DefaultDoxia.java  |   32 +-
 .../main/java/org/apache/maven/doxia/Doxia.java    |   20 +-
 .../org/apache/maven/doxia/index/IndexEntry.java   |  136 +-
 .../org/apache/maven/doxia/index/IndexingSink.java |  137 +-
 .../apache/maven/doxia/macro/AbstractMacro.java    |   23 +-
 .../org/apache/maven/doxia/macro/EchoMacro.java    |   25 +-
 .../java/org/apache/maven/doxia/macro/Macro.java   |   11 +-
 .../maven/doxia/macro/MacroExecutionException.java |   22 +-
 .../org/apache/maven/doxia/macro/MacroRequest.java |   47 +-
 .../doxia/macro/manager/DefaultMacroManager.java   |   24 +-
 .../maven/doxia/macro/manager/MacroManager.java    |   10 +-
 .../macro/manager/MacroNotFoundException.java      |   24 +-
 .../maven/doxia/macro/snippet/SnippetMacro.java    |  234 ++-
 .../maven/doxia/macro/snippet/SnippetReader.java   |  132 +-
 .../org/apache/maven/doxia/macro/toc/TocMacro.java |  119 +-
 .../org/apache/maven/doxia/markup/HtmlMarkup.java  |  640 +++-----
 .../java/org/apache/maven/doxia/markup/Markup.java |   10 +-
 .../org/apache/maven/doxia/markup/TextMarkup.java  |    9 +-
 .../org/apache/maven/doxia/markup/XmlMarkup.java   |   10 +-
 .../apache/maven/doxia/parser/AbstractParser.java  |  113 +-
 .../maven/doxia/parser/AbstractTextParser.java     |   11 +-
 .../maven/doxia/parser/AbstractXmlParser.java      |  494 +++---
 .../apache/maven/doxia/parser/ParseException.java  |   58 +-
 .../java/org/apache/maven/doxia/parser/Parser.java |   18 +-
 .../maven/doxia/parser/Xhtml5BaseParser.java       | 1170 +++++---------
 .../doxia/parser/manager/DefaultParserManager.java |   24 +-
 .../maven/doxia/parser/manager/ParserManager.java  |    9 +-
 .../parser/manager/ParserNotFoundException.java    |   24 +-
 .../doxia/parser/module/AbstractParserModule.java  |   34 +-
 .../parser/module/DefaultParserModuleManager.java  |   31 +-
 .../maven/doxia/parser/module/ParserModule.java    |    6 +-
 .../doxia/parser/module/ParserModuleManager.java   |    9 +-
 .../module/ParserModuleNotFoundException.java      |   24 +-
 .../apache/maven/doxia/sink/impl/AbstractSink.java |   73 +-
 .../maven/doxia/sink/impl/AbstractTextSink.java    |    9 +-
 .../doxia/sink/impl/AbstractTextSinkFactory.java   |   49 +-
 .../maven/doxia/sink/impl/AbstractXmlSink.java     |  100 +-
 .../doxia/sink/impl/AbstractXmlSinkFactory.java    |    9 +-
 .../apache/maven/doxia/sink/impl/PipelineSink.java |   34 +-
 .../maven/doxia/sink/impl/RandomAccessSink.java    |  686 +++-----
 .../apache/maven/doxia/sink/impl/SinkAdapter.java  |  586 +++----
 .../doxia/sink/impl/SinkEventAttributeSet.java     |  302 ++--
 .../apache/maven/doxia/sink/impl/SinkUtils.java    |  187 +--
 .../maven/doxia/sink/impl/Xhtml5BaseSink.java      | 1604 ++++++++----------
 .../maven/doxia/util/ByLineReaderSource.java       |   68 +-
 .../org/apache/maven/doxia/util/ByLineSource.java  |   10 +-
 .../org/apache/maven/doxia/util/DoxiaUtils.java    |  217 ++-
 .../org/apache/maven/doxia/util/HtmlTools.java     |  397 ++---
 .../org/apache/maven/doxia/util/LineBreaker.java   |  113 +-
 .../org/apache/maven/doxia/util/XmlValidator.java  |  143 +-
 doxia-core/src/site/apt/using-randomaccesssink.apt |    2 +-
 .../org/apache/maven/doxia/AbstractModuleTest.java |  105 +-
 .../org/apache/maven/doxia/DefaultDoxiaTest.java   |   21 +-
 .../apache/maven/doxia/index/IndexEntryTest.java   |   44 +-
 .../apache/maven/doxia/index/IndexingSinkTest.java |   17 +-
 .../apache/maven/doxia/macro/EchoMacroTest.java    |   33 +-
 .../doxia/macro/manager/MacroManagerTest.java      |   19 +-
 .../doxia/macro/snippet/SnippetMacroTest.java      |  127 +-
 .../doxia/macro/snippet/SnippetReaderTest.java     |   88 +-
 .../apache/maven/doxia/macro/toc/TocMacroTest.java |  157 +-
 .../maven/doxia/module/AbstractIdentityTest.java   |   62 +-
 .../maven/doxia/parser/AbstractParserTest.java     |   95 +-
 .../maven/doxia/parser/AbstractParserTestCase.java |   24 +-
 .../maven/doxia/parser/Xhtml5BaseParserTest.java   |  956 ++++++-----
 .../maven/doxia/sink/impl/AbstractSinkTest.java    |  712 ++++----
 .../doxia/sink/impl/AbstractSinkTestCase.java      |   47 +-
 .../maven/doxia/sink/impl/AbstractXmlSinkTest.java |  117 +-
 .../doxia/sink/impl/RandomAccessSinkTest.java      |  205 ++-
 .../maven/doxia/sink/impl/SinkAdapterTest.java     |  357 ++---
 .../doxia/sink/impl/SinkEventAttributeSetTest.java |  250 ++-
 .../maven/doxia/sink/impl/SinkEventElement.java    |   28 +-
 .../doxia/sink/impl/SinkEventTestingSink.java      |  833 ++++------
 .../maven/doxia/sink/impl/SinkTestDocument.java    |  327 ++--
 .../maven/doxia/sink/impl/SinkUtilsTest.java       |   61 +-
 .../maven/doxia/sink/impl/TestAbstractSink.java    |   93 +-
 .../org/apache/maven/doxia/sink/impl/TextSink.java |  797 ++++-----
 .../sink/impl/WellformednessCheckingSink.java      |  747 ++++-----
 .../maven/doxia/sink/impl/Xhtml5BaseSinkTest.java  | 1285 ++++++---------
 .../maven/doxia/util/ByLineReaderSourceTest.java   |   35 +-
 .../apache/maven/doxia/util/DoxiaUtilsTest.java    |  202 ++-
 .../org/apache/maven/doxia/util/HtmlToolsTest.java |  177 +-
 .../apache/maven/doxia/util/XmlValidatorTest.java  |   14 +-
 .../maven/doxia/xsd/AbstractXmlValidator.java      |  282 ++--
 .../maven/doxia/xsd/AbstractXmlValidatorTest.java  |  120 +-
 doxia-modules/doxia-module-apt/pom.xml             |   26 +-
 .../apache/maven/doxia/module/apt/AptMarkup.java   |   73 +-
 .../maven/doxia/module/apt/AptParseException.java  |   32 +-
 .../apache/maven/doxia/module/apt/AptParser.java   | 1695 +++++++-------------
 .../maven/doxia/module/apt/AptParserModule.java    |   14 +-
 .../maven/doxia/module/apt/AptReaderSource.java    |   51 +-
 .../org/apache/maven/doxia/module/apt/AptSink.java |  784 ++++-----
 .../maven/doxia/module/apt/AptSinkFactory.java     |   14 +-
 .../apache/maven/doxia/module/apt/AptSource.java   |   10 +-
 .../apache/maven/doxia/module/apt/AptUtils.java    |   54 +-
 .../maven/doxia/module/apt/AptIdentityTest.java    |   15 +-
 .../maven/doxia/module/apt/AptParserTest.java      |  552 ++++---
 .../apache/maven/doxia/module/apt/AptSinkTest.java |  361 ++---
 .../maven/doxia/module/apt/AptUtilsTest.java       |   70 +-
 .../src/test/resources/test/authors.apt            |    6 +
 .../src/test/resources/test/font.apt               |    1 +
 doxia-modules/doxia-module-fml/pom.xml             |   56 +-
 .../maven/doxia/module/fml/FmlContentParser.java   |   78 +-
 .../apache/maven/doxia/module/fml/FmlMarkup.java   |   51 +-
 .../apache/maven/doxia/module/fml/FmlParser.java   |  554 +++----
 .../maven/doxia/module/fml/FmlParserModule.java    |   14 +-
 .../maven/doxia/module/fml/FmlParserTest.java      |  315 ++--
 .../maven/doxia/module/fml/FmlValidatorTest.java   |   39 +-
 doxia-modules/doxia-module-markdown/pom.xml        |  100 +-
 .../src/it/general/verify.groovy                   |   26 +-
 .../module/markdown/FlexmarkDoxiaLinkResolver.java |   55 +-
 .../doxia/module/markdown/MarkdownMarkup.java      |  120 ++
 .../doxia/module/markdown/MarkdownParser.java      |  317 ++--
 .../module/markdown/MarkdownParserModule.java      |   14 +-
 .../maven/doxia/module/markdown/MarkdownSink.java  | 1013 ++++++++++++
 .../module/markdown/MarkdownSinkFactory.java}      |   21 +-
 .../module/markdown/YamlFrontMatterVisitor.java}   |   34 +-
 .../doxia-module-markdown/src/site/apt/index.apt   |   11 +-
 .../markdown/FlexmarkDoxiaLinkResolverTest.java    |  144 +-
 .../module/markdown/MarkdownParserModuleTest.java  |   11 +-
 .../doxia/module/markdown/MarkdownParserTest.java  |  779 ++++++---
 .../doxia/module/markdown/MarkdownSinkTest.java    |  442 +++++
 .../src/test/resources/metadata-yaml.md            |   19 +
 .../src/test/resources/metadata.md                 |    5 +-
 doxia-modules/doxia-module-xdoc/pom.xml            |   54 +-
 .../apache/maven/doxia/module/xdoc/XdocMarkup.java |   57 +-
 .../apache/maven/doxia/module/xdoc/XdocParser.java |  445 ++---
 .../maven/doxia/module/xdoc/XdocParserModule.java  |   14 +-
 .../apache/maven/doxia/module/xdoc/XdocSink.java   |  357 ++---
 .../maven/doxia/module/xdoc/XdocSinkFactory.java   |   19 +-
 .../maven/doxia/module/xdoc/XdocIdentityTest.java  |   45 +-
 .../maven/doxia/module/xdoc/XdocParserTest.java    |  379 +++--
 .../maven/doxia/module/xdoc/XdocSinkTest.java      |  248 ++-
 .../module/xdoc/XdocSinkWithLanguageIdTest.java    |   23 +-
 .../maven/doxia/module/xdoc/XdocValidatorTest.java |   39 +-
 doxia-modules/doxia-module-xhtml5/pom.xml          |   20 +-
 .../doxia/module/xhtml5/AbstractXhtml5Sink.java    |    8 +-
 .../maven/doxia/module/xhtml5/Xhtml5Markup.java    |    9 +-
 .../maven/doxia/module/xhtml5/Xhtml5Parser.java    |  301 ++--
 .../doxia/module/xhtml5/Xhtml5ParserModule.java    |   14 +-
 .../maven/doxia/module/xhtml5/Xhtml5Sink.java      |  131 +-
 .../doxia/module/xhtml5/Xhtml5SinkFactory.java     |   19 +-
 .../doxia/module/xhtml5/Xhtml5IdentityTest.java    |   46 +-
 .../doxia/module/xhtml5/Xhtml5ParserTest.java      |  151 +-
 .../maven/doxia/module/xhtml5/Xhtml5SinkTest.java  |  276 ++--
 .../xhtml5/Xhtml5SinkWithLanguageIdTest.java       |   22 +-
 .../src/test/resources/index.xml.vm                |   10 +-
 .../src/test/resources/test.xhtml                  |   30 +-
 doxia-modules/pom.xml                              |    9 +-
 doxia-sink-api/pom.xml                             |    6 +-
 .../java/org/apache/maven/doxia/sink/Sink.java     |  152 +-
 .../maven/doxia/sink/SinkEventAttributes.java      |   15 +-
 .../org/apache/maven/doxia/sink/SinkFactory.java   |   18 +-
 doxia-sink-api/src/site/apt/index.apt              |    2 +-
 doxia-test-docs/pom.xml                            |    4 +-
 .../resources/maven-dependency-plugin/fml/faq.fml  |    2 +-
 .../resources/maven-javadoc-plugin/fml/faq.fml     |    8 +-
 .../src/main/resources/maven-site/fml/maven1.fml   |    2 +-
 .../xdoc/developers/mojo-api-specification.xml     |   30 +-
 .../resources/maven-site/xdoc/docs-required.xml    |    2 +-
 .../main/resources/maven-site/xdoc/index.xml.vm    |    4 +-
 pom.xml                                            |   83 +-
 src/site/xdoc/download.xml.vm                      |   76 +-
 165 files changed, 12636 insertions(+), 15213 deletions(-)
 copy .github/workflows/maven-verify.yml => .git-blame-ignore-revs (78%)
 create mode 100644 doxia-modules/doxia-module-apt/src/test/resources/test/authors.apt
 create mode 100644 doxia-modules/doxia-module-apt/src/test/resources/test/font.apt
 create mode 100644 doxia-modules/doxia-module-markdown/src/main/java/org/apache/maven/doxia/module/markdown/MarkdownMarkup.java
 create mode 100644 doxia-modules/doxia-module-markdown/src/main/java/org/apache/maven/doxia/module/markdown/MarkdownSink.java
 copy doxia-modules/{doxia-module-apt/src/main/java/org/apache/maven/doxia/module/apt/AptSinkFactory.java => doxia-module-markdown/src/main/java/org/apache/maven/doxia/module/markdown/MarkdownSinkFactory.java} (73%)
 copy doxia-modules/doxia-module-markdown/src/{test/java/org/apache/maven/doxia/module/markdown/MarkdownParserModuleTest.java => main/java/org/apache/maven/doxia/module/markdown/YamlFrontMatterVisitor.java} (61%)
 create mode 100644 doxia-modules/doxia-module-markdown/src/test/java/org/apache/maven/doxia/module/markdown/MarkdownSinkTest.java
 create mode 100644 doxia-modules/doxia-module-markdown/src/test/resources/metadata-yaml.md